Originally Posted By: BuickGN
Typically it's engines with forged pistons that have cold piston slap.

Forged pistons expand more when hot so cold, the clearances are looser.


The LSx engines notorious for it use hypereutectic pistons FWIW.

The reason is that GM went from hand-fitting the pistons in the bores to bulk boring and bulk pistons. So you end up with some pistons that are, due the the inherent nature of mass manufacture, smaller than average and some bores that, due to the same reason, are larger than average. This creates noise of course. Combined with the almost complete lack of skirt on the LSx pistons and it really is a no-brainer as to why it happens.
